First things first, let's dive into what these AI sensors are all about. Essentially, they're like tiny, intelligent detectives that constantly monitor your fish farm's water quality and environment. By analyzing data in real-time, they can detect signs of disease early on, allowing you to take immediate action and prevent outbreaks before they become a problem.

- Choose the right AI sensor for your needs
The first step is to select the right AI sensor for your farm. There are various types available, so it's important to do your research. Look for sensors that offer comprehensive monitoring, including parameters like pH, dissolved oxygen, ammonia, and temperature. Additionally, some sensors are designed specifically for certain species or types of fish farming, so make sure you choose one that aligns with your farming goals.
- Install sensors strategically
Once you've got your sensors, it's time to install them. Place them in key areas of your farm, such as near water intakes, in fish tanks, or in pond beds. The goal is to get a representative sample of your farm's environment. If you're dealing with multiple tanks or ponds, consider using multiple sensors to ensure you cover all your bases.
- Set up a monitoring system
To make the most of your AI sensors, you'll need a reliable monitoring system. This can be a simple data logger or a more advanced, cloud-based platform. The monitoring system should allow you to view real-time data, receive alerts when parameters deviate from optimal levels, and store historical data for analysis. Some systems even offer predictive analytics, which can help you anticipate future issues before they become a problem.
- Learn to interpret the data
Now that you've got your sensors up and running, it's crucial to learn how to interpret the data they provide. This may take some time and practice, but it's worth it. Keep an eye out for trends, anomalies, and any signs of potential disease outbreaks. For example, a sudden drop in dissolved oxygen levels or a rise in ammonia could indicate a problem.
- Take immediate action
When you notice something out of the ordinary, it's time to take action. Here are some steps you can take to address common issues:
- Adjust water flow and aeration to maintain optimal dissolved oxygen levels.
- Conduct regular water quality tests and treat any harmful bacteria or parasites.
- Monitor your fish closely for signs of stress or illness, such as loss of appetite, discoloration, or fin erosion.
-
Consult with a veterinarian or a fish health specialist for advice on treatment and prevention.
-
Maintain and calibrate your sensors
To ensure your AI sensors continue to provide accurate data, it's essential to maintain and calibrate them regularly. This may involve cleaning the sensors, replacing batteries, and updating firmware. By keeping your sensors in good working order, you can trust that they'll continue to protect your fish farm from disease outbreaks.
